About ThreadPort
ThreadPort is a browser extension for Chrome and Edge that moves an active AI chat between ChatGPT, Claude, and Gemini in one click. It extracts the conversation you're currently in, cleans out UI elements like widgets and buttons, and pastes it into another AI service with context intact. The tool runs entirely in the browser with no servers and no account required.
Review
ThreadPort launched this week and addresses a specific workflow problem for people who switch between multiple AI assistants. Each service has its own strengths and rate limits, but copying conversations manually often loses formatting and context. This extension automates that transfer.
Key Features
- One-click transfer of the active chat to another AI service, preserving the full conversation thread as context
- DOM-based extraction that strips out UI clutter such as buttons, citations, and widgets before pasting
- No server-side processing; all data stays in the browser, which also means it's operational in the EU
- Free tier allows 10 transfers per month with no account or tracking
- Works as a browser extension on both Chrome and Edge
Pricing and Value
The extension is free for 10 transfers per month. The maker has not defined a paid tier or stated pricing beyond that free allocation. There's no subscription or account creation required for the free tier, and the extension doesn't rely on any server infrastructure that could incur ongoing costs for its operation.
Pros
- Removes the friction of manual copy-paste across AI chat interfaces.
- Preserves conversation context, which matters for follow-up questions.
- Runs without servers or accounts, keeping user data in the local browser.
- EU availability where some native AI import tools are unsupported.
- Built with Claude Code, which the maker credits for the extraction strategies and debugging.
Cons
- Depends on page layouts; the maker acknowledges that a site redesign can break the extension until a fix ships.
- The 10-transfer monthly cap may feel restrictive for daily users who bounce between multiple AIs.
- Not for people who use Safari, Firefox, or desktop apps, since the extension targets only Chromium browsers.
ThreadPort suits frequent users of ChatGPT, Claude, or Gemini who need an occasional conversation carried over when switching tools. It's also a parent choice for those in the EU where certain native import options are unavailable. For anyone requiring high-volume transfers or non-Chromium support, it doesn't fit yet, though the maker has stated Firefox is a possible next step.
